Increased physical activity, not weight loss, gives individuals with coronary heart disease a longer lease on life, according to a new study conducted at the Norwegian University of Science and Technology (NTNU).
Patients who develop ovarian cancer appear to have better outcomes if they have a history of oral contraceptive use, according to a study by Mayo Clinic researchers published in the current issue of the journal BMC Cancer.
Following a Priority Review, Health Canada has approved Prevnar 13 (Pneumococcal 13-valent Conjugate Vaccine (Diphtheria CRM197 Protein)) for children aged six weeks through five years for active immunization against invasive pneumococcal disease, a bacterial infection that can include meningitis (inflammation of the coverings of the brain and spinal cord), sepsis (bloodstream infection), bacteremic pneumonia, pleural empyema (accumulation of pus in the cavity surrounding the lungs) and bacteremia (bacteria in the blood).
The Florida Times-Union: Stopping the "medicalization" of good health is being targeted again by economists and policymakers as a way to stem health care costs. "If Americans would stop thinking of certain problems in a medical context, experts argue, it might chip away at the more than $2 trillion the nation spends annually on health care.
Lung cancers account for approximately 25 percent of all cancer deaths. Even among those who do not smoke, 1 in 15 men and 1 in 17 women are expected to develop lung cancer in their lifetime, according to the American Cancer Society.
